7. ARCNET
The New ARCNET-based bus system enables connection between an ARCNET system
and an Ethernet system. This realizes addition of Ethernet analyzers to existing ARCNET
systems.
A typical network configuration of analyzer bus is shown in Figure 7.1.
The network consists of analyzers (Gas chromatograph etc.) and "Analyzer bus sys-
tems for ARCNET". This "Analyzer bus systems for ARCNET" consist of “Gateway
unit”,”analyzer server” and “ARCNET / Ethernet Converter”.
Each software (PCAS, ASET) for “Analyzer server” and “Analyzer Server Engineering
Terminal” should be used ARCNET edition “/ARC”.
The communication to the analyzer connected to Ethernet is also enabled.
• "Analyzer bus systems for ARCNET" should be used so that DCS communicates
with analyzer connected to ARCNET.
• Redundancy for ARCNET is enabled. Redundancy for Ethernet can be done by using
double "Analyzer bus systems for ARCNET".
• One "Analyzer bus systems for ARCNET" can communicate with up to 30 sets of
analyzers connected to ARCNET. In case of communicating with more than 31 sets,
plural number of "Analyzer bus systems for ARCNET" should be used.
